Reading Suggestions for Fall

Here are some books to read together with children aged 3-8 to celebrate the arrival of fall.


A is for Autumn
Robert Maass
ABC MAA

Partake in the wonders of the fall through rich images of nature, family, and friends. Perfect for preschoolers, this alphabet book features the special and often magical moments of the season - complete with apples, leaves, frost and more.




Sneeze, Big Bear, Sneeze!
Maureen Wright
E WRI

Big Bear thinks that his tremendous sneezes are causing the leaves and apples to fall off the trees and the geese to fly away, but when the wind finally convinces him otherwise, he knows what to do.



How Do We Know it is Fall?
Molly Aloian
EZ 577.23 A453f

Why is fall the most appropriately named season? Readers will learn the answer to this question and much more in this captivating book. From cooler temperatures and fewer daylight hours to colourful leaves and warmer clothing, readers will discover the many signs of the fall season.



We Gather Together: Celebrating the Harvest Season
Wendy Pfeffer
j577.23 P524w

The fall equinox signals the time of year when we gather our harvests and give thanks for their bounty. This nonfiction picture book explains the science behind autumn and the social history of harvest-time celebrations. We Gather Together presents a remarkable range of cultural traditions throughout the ages and the world, many of which have influenced our contemporary Thanksgiving holiday.
